1) Figure Out What You Need
When you’re looking for a private tutor, it is important to first assess your needs. Consider the type of tutoring you are looking for, as well as the type of skills that you need help with. For example, if you are looking for help in math, you may want to look for a tutor who specializes in math. Additionally, if you are having difficulty with a specific subject or concept, such as algebra, you may want to look for a tutor who specializes in that particular area.

Another important factor to consider is the type of learner you are and the best way that you learn. Different tutors have different teaching styles, so it is important to find a tutor who aligns with your own learning style. Do you prefer to work in small groups or one-on-one? Do you like lectures or hands-on learning? Knowing your own learning style can help narrow down the field when searching for a private tutor.
2) Do Your Research
When you’re looking for a private tutor, research is key. Look into the background of potential tutors to make sure they have the qualifications necessary to help your child succeed. It’s important to consider the type of experience they have and whether or not they are certified. Additionally, be sure to ask if they’ve worked with students of similar age or ability level to your child.
You can also look at the reviews left by past students or their parents. Reviews are often a good way to gauge the quality of a tutor, so take the time to read what others have said about them. Also, look at any websites or social media accounts associated with the tutor to get an idea of their teaching style and approach.

Finally, make sure you ask potential tutors about their tutoring fees and payment policies. Many tutors have flexible rates and payment plans, so it’s important to make sure you understand all the details before committing.
3) Ask For Recommendations
Asking for recommendations is one of the best ways to find a great private tutor. Ask your friends, family, or colleagues if they have any recommendations for someone who has been successful in tutoring similar subjects. Ask if they are pleased with the quality of instruction they received and how reliable the tutor was. If they can provide you with a few names, contact each tutor and explain what you’re looking for in detail. Ask them to provide you with their qualifications, experience and references.
If you are unable to find a recommendation from someone you know, try looking for reviews online. Look for independent reviews from reliable sources such as past students or even professional organizations that provide certifications for tutors. These can give you a good indication of whether a tutor is reputable or not.
